Since 1837, Tiffany & Co. has inspired people to express and celebrate the many facets of love. Known for visionary artistry and exceptional craftsmanship, the House’s coveted bracelets, necklaces, earrings, rings and fine watches will be cherished for generations. Explore our legendary engagement rings and iconic jewelry collections, such as HardWear by Tiffany and Lock by Tiffany, and extraordinary gifts—many of which can be personalized with initials, a date or a special message.
